A Tennessee man, Cleotha Abston, has been sentenced to 80 years in prison for raping a woman in 2021, a year before being charged with the kidnapping and murder of a school teacher. Shelby County Criminal Court Judge Lee Coffee handed down the sentence on Friday, allocating 40 years for aggravated rape, 20 years for…